☐ Key ceremony, step 4 (FeedGrove validator): before we rotate the signing key the podcast feed validator uses to stamp verified feeds, double-check that the old key is archived and the witness (Priya or Tomás) has initialed the log. Then open the hardware vault in the Kestrel Room — it'll prompt you for the recovery passphrase below.

unlock words, yawig-kagef: gordor-holvan-ulaael-pramir-ulaiel-tamdor

Quotas on the Fernhollow Gateway are enforced per tenant, not per user. Defaults: 600 requests/minute, burst of 100, reset on a rolling window. Exceeding a quota returns 429 with a `Retry-After` header — honor it; hammering the endpoint extends the penalty window. Quota overrides live in the tenant config service and require a change ticket. To inspect current usage, call the internal metering endpoint, which authenticates separately from the public gateway. Use the key below for that service.

API key for tajog-bajof: kto15_6fvgvYZbOKdLifh

Handover — Priya to Danek, Quillbase replica lag alarm. The reader-2 node has been trailing primary by 40–90 seconds since the schema migration Tuesday. Alarm fires at 60s, so expect intermittent pages. Root cause is likely the unindexed backfill job; it finishes around 03:00. If lag exceeds 300s, promote reader-3 and detach reader-2 per the standard playbook. Vacuum runs were paused; resume them after the backfill completes. To unlock the replica admin console you'll need the recovery passphrase below.

vault phrase of bagaf-kajeg = jorath-feniel-briir-siliel-ralix

### Step 4: Deploy the EXIF scrubber

Scrubline removes EXIF metadata from user uploads before storage. After building, run the golden-image tests — they confirm GPS, serial, and timestamp fields are stripped without corrupting image data. Never skip these; a regression here leaks user location data. Once tests pass, package the build and sign it, since the Harrowgate ingest cluster rejects unsigned artifacts. Sign using the deploy key below.

deploy key for kajof-fajop: bky6_gDHw9Q